ABC News: Bush Sends Condolences to Asia, Offers Aid
http://abcnews.go.com/Politics/wireStory?id=360856

CRAWFORD, Texas Dec 26, 2004 — President Bush expressed his condolences Sunday to the victims of the massive earthquake and tidal waves that hit southern and southeast Asia. Officials said U.S. relief efforts already were underway.

"The United States stands ready to offer all appropriate assistance to those nations most affected," deputy presidential press secretary Trent Duffy said in a statement.

The statement, issued aboard Air Force One en route to Texas from Washington, said "the president expresses his sincere condolences" over the "terrible loss of life and suffering" caused by the earthquake and tidal waves that hit six countries.
